I like the shops to browse and sometimes pick up some perfume or make-up but I have found on all lines that there is quite a limited range, especially of make-up. It is good if what they have is the kind you wear/need but rarely have I found the actual product I use. There are usually lots of palettes with for example, eyes, lips and cheeks and a couple of brushes and sometimes twin packs of products which is a bit annoying. The L'Occitane range I have found very limited with gift sets of small hand creams etc. Have not seen Body Shop or Jurlique on board from memory though may be wrong. Seems to be primarily ones like Dior or Chanel and also some of the 'therapuetic' brands. The perfume range seems to be better though often it is the 100mm bottles rather than the smaller ones.

If you are buying handbags/wallets etc be careful to check where they are made. For example,many of the Furla products (and I would assume other luxury brands) were not Italian made and were produced in Thailand or similar. It would be disappointing to assume that you had purchased an Italian bag when it wasn't. I know most of the brands do offshore some of their production but it is easy to be taken in with the brand name and in the onboard shop where it looks a good price. I did see that the more expensive bags were Italian in origin.
